Garrett became USC's first Heisman Trophy winner in 1965 and began a run of four USC running backs to win Heismans which ended in 1981 with Marcus Allen's stiff-arm trophy. The other Heisman winners in that 17-season stretch were OJ Simpson (1968) and Charles White (1979).

Patterson, a 65-year-old College Football Hall of Fame coach, was named USC’s next defensive coordinator Friday. While he is most known for his 24-season run at TCU, where he won six conference championships and made 17 bowl games, Patterson took to his lesser-known hobby of songwriting to commemorate the moment.
